Now pay through EMI for your railway tickets - NEWS

INDIAN RAILWAY'S INNOVATIVE STEP:

New Delhi: In a innovative step, Indian Railway has introduced Equated Monthly Installment (EMI) system of payment for its tickets. Now you can book a ticket and pay it in installments.

But there is a catch in this. Only those who will book ticket online will get this benefit.

For this purpose Indian Railway’s online booking website, IRCTC, has added one more mode of payment in it and that is EMI option, in addition to credit, debit and net banking options.

For now, only Citi bank credit card holders will have the privilege of paying through EMI.

This is how the tickets will be booked through EMI :

During the booking process there will be credit, debit, net banking and EMI option in the website. As soon as you will click on EMI option, credit card details will be asked. Once you will submit all the details, entire ticket amount will be deducted from credit card and will be transferred in IRCTC's account but bank will break the payment for you into EMIs.
